当前位置:首页 > 企业级应用系统中的数据库访问优化策略探析
龙源期刊网 http://www.qikan.com.cn
企业级应用系统中的数据库访问优化策略探析
作者:吴挺
来源:《数字技术与应用》2017年第02期
摘要:企业级数据库应用系统不仅数据量较大,同时对并行访问的需求也比较高,因此访问数据库过程中不可避免的会面临一些问题,因此如何快速处理数据成为人们关注的问题。文章主要介绍了几种JDBC访问类型,并在其分析与对比基础上提出了使用过程中的选择协议,利用JDBC建立数据库连接的同时提出了连接池技术,就如何提升企业级应用系统数据库访问率提出了一些见解,供大家参考。
关键词:企业级应用系统;数据库访问;优化策略
中图分类号:TP311.13 文献标识码:A 文章编号:1007-9416(2017)02-0234-01 1 数据库设计概述
数据库设计具体包括逻辑与物理设计两方面内容,其中逻辑设计主要是指利用数据库组件进行数据建模,不需要考虑在哪里存储数据,物理设计是指将逻辑映射到媒体上,利用软硬件加强对数据库的物理访问和维护。 1.1 逻辑数据库设计
逻辑设计的主要目的在于产生一个数据模型与数据库模式,该模式一定要满足数据库在一致性、完整性等方面的用户需求,将冗余数据去除,同时提升数据的吞吐量,充分保证数据的完整性,将数据元素清楚的表达出来。通常情况下数据库逻辑设计应遵循规范化前三级标准,第一范式需要除去任何多值属性,第二范式中每个非关键字字段都要依赖于关键字,而第三范式则是在第二范式的基础上对关键字段函数进行传递。 1.2 物理数据库设计
大部分情况下系统使用的数据库管理技术一旦被选定,那么就确定了很多物理数据库设计的问题。在物理设计中为了避免降低系统性能,开发人员必须遵循以下几方面策略:①为每个属性选择合理的数据类型,以达到存储空间最小、性能最佳;②将数据库分区,将大表拆成不同的小表,在提升查询速度的同时使任务更快得到执行和维护;③利用文件组放置数据,将相似的结构放在同一文件组中,在文件组创建索引,利用控制器和物理驱动器提升性能;④优化数据库日志,具体来说可以从下面几方面进行考虑:第一,在单独磁盘上创建日志,第二,将
共分享92篇相关文档